I agree with John - most accurate is always one where you can program your own stats in. If the machine is asking for your weight, you can trust calories burned a little more. The machine looks absolutely cool - hope my bosses are thinking about getting a couple of 'em...

Disagree that it's as simple as heart rate only (you knew I wasn't going to let that one slide, John!). Experts split about 50-50 on this one, according to my study materials. You shouldn't be exceeding your maximum for any length of time, and you can over-exercise. It's part of what causes stalls and plateaus in weight loss, among many other factors.
